@media print,screen and (min-width: 820px){#ginzacurry .history .ginzacurry_contents{padding-bottom:2%}}#ginzacurry .history .read{margin:20px auto;color:#821a1f;text-align:center;font-weight:bold;font-size:3.8vw;line-height:1.8}@media print,screen and (min-width: 820px){#ginzacurry .history .read{font-size:18px;line-height:2}}#ginzacurry .history .year_menu{display:flex;flex-wrap:wrap;justify-content:space-between;width:90%;margin:30px auto}#ginzacurry .history .year_menu li{width:48%;height:54px;background:url(../images/common/icon_arrow6.svg) no-repeat left 25px center #552e31;background-size:18px 18px}@media print,screen and (max-width: 819px){#ginzacurry .history .year_menu li{width:49%}}#ginzacurry .history .year_menu li a{display:flex;align-items:center;justify-content:center;width:100%;height:100%;padding:0 40px 0 65px}@media print,screen and (max-width: 819px){#ginzacurry .history .year_menu li a{padding:0 30px 0 55px}}#ginzacurry .history .year_menu li:nth-child(n+2){margin-bottom:5%}@media print,screen and (max-width: 819px){#ginzacurry .history .year_menu li:nth-child(n+2){margin-bottom:2%}}#ginzacurry .history .history_body{width:90%;margin:0 auto;padding:8% 8% 0;background-color:#fff}@media print,screen and (max-width: 819px){#ginzacurry .history .history_body{padding:8% 5% 0}}#ginzacurry .history .history_list{position:relative;width:100%;padding:10% 0 0}#ginzacurry .history .history_item{position:relative;padding-bottom:70px}#ginzacurry .history .history_item::before{content:"";display:block;position:absolute;left:0;bottom:0;height:100%;border-left:solid 2px #920e14}#ginzacurry .history .history_item:nth-of-type(1)::before{height:98%}#ginzacurry .history .history_item.second{margin-top:30px}#ginzacurry .history .history_item.pb_half{padding-bottom:30px}#ginzacurry .history .history_item h3{position:relative;display:flex;align-items:center;width:150px;padding-left:10px}@media print,screen and (max-width: 819px){#ginzacurry .history .history_item h3{width:120px}}#ginzacurry .history .history_item h3 img{width:65px}#ginzacurry .history .history_item h3::before{content:"";display:block;position:absolute;left:-6px;top:4px;width:14px;height:14px;border-radius:100%;background-color:#920e14}#ginzacurry .history .history_item h3::after{content:"";display:block;height:2px;background:url(../images/history/line.png) no-repeat left 10px top;background-size:auto 2px;flex-grow:1}#ginzacurry .history .history_item.last{padding-bottom:20px}#ginzacurry .history .history_item_body{padding-left:80px}#ginzacurry .history .mt10{margin-top:10px}#ginzacurry .history .history_item_link{width:200px;height:130px;margin:-70px 40px 5px auto;padding:34px 20px 0 0;background:url(../images/history/menu_bg.png) no-repeat center top;background-size:200px auto;cursor:pointer}@media print,screen and (max-width: 819px){#ginzacurry .history .history_item_link{margin-right:0}}#ginzacurry .history .history_item_link.mt10{margin-top:10px}#ginzacurry .history .history_item_link span{display:flex;flex-direction:column;justify-content:center;align-items:center;height:80px;text-align:center;color:#920e14;font-size:16px;font-weight:bold;line-height:1.2}@media print,screen and (max-width: 819px){#ginzacurry .history .history_item_link span{font-size:3.2vw}}#ginzacurry .history .history_item_link span img{width:22px;height:22px;margin-top:5px}#ginzacurry .history .history_item_txt{width:75px;font-size:14px;line-height:1.5}@media print,screen and (max-width: 819px){#ginzacurry .history .history_item_txt{font-size:3.2vw}}#ginzacurry .history .history_item_txt span{display:inline-block;margin-bottom:5px;padding:3px 6px;background-color:#930e14;border-radius:5px;color:#fff;font-size:15px;font-weight:bold;line-height:1.2}@media print,screen and (max-width: 819px){#ginzacurry .history .history_item_txt span{font-size:3.2vw}}#ginzacurry .history .history_item_pic{height:100px;margin-top:10px;text-align:center}#ginzacurry .history .history_item_pic img{width:auto;height:100%}#ginzacurry .history .history_item_pic.half{width:70%;margin:0 auto}#ginzacurry .history .history_item_pic.half img{width:100%;height:auto}#ginzacurry .history .history_item_pic.all img{width:100%;height:auto}#ginzacurry .history .history_item_flex{display:flex;justify-content:center;align-items:center}#ginzacurry .history .history_item_flex .history_item_txt.all{width:100%}#ginzacurry .history .history_item_flex .history_item_pic{margin:0 0 0 10px}#ginzacurry .history .history_item_flex.frozen{align-items:center}#ginzacurry .history .history_item_flex.frozen .history_item_type{width:60%;margin-top:0}#ginzacurry .history .history_item_flex.frozen .history_item_pic{width:40%;height:auto}#ginzacurry .history .history_item_flex.frozen .history_item_pic img{height:auto}#ginzacurry .history .history_item_type{display:flex;align-items:center;margin-top:20px}#ginzacurry .history .history_item_type dt{width:34px}#ginzacurry .history .history_item_type dd{width:calc(100% - 34px);padding-left:10px;font-size:16px;font-weight:bold}@media print,screen and (max-width: 819px){#ginzacurry .history .history_item_type dd{font-size:3.3vw}}#modal{display:none;position:fixed;left:0;right:0;top:0;bottom:0;width:100%;height:100%;z-index:15000;overflow:auto;box-sizing:border-box}#modal *{box-sizing:border-box}@media print,screen and (max-width: 819px){#modal{height:100vh;min-height:100%;padding:10%}}#modal #modal_bg{position:fixed;left:0;top:0;width:100%;height:100%;background-color:rgba(51,51,51,.7);cursor:pointer}#modal #modal_history{position:absolute;left:50%;top:50%;width:530px;background-color:#f5aa00;border:solid 10px #fff;transform:translate(-50%, -50%);box-shadow:0 0 10px rgba(0,0,0,.7)}@media print,screen and (max-width: 819px){#modal #modal_history{width:90%}}#modal #modal_history_body{padding:20px 10px 50px}#modal #modal_history_body .history_detail_year{position:relative;width:100%;height:190px;margin-bottom:20px;background:url(../images/history/year_detail_bg.png) no-repeat center center;background-size:auto 100%}@media print,screen and (max-width: 819px){#modal #modal_history_body .history_detail_year{height:150px}}#modal #modal_history_body .history_detail_year img{position:absolute;left:50%;top:20px;width:75px;height:30px;transform:translateX(-50%)}@media print,screen and (max-width: 819px){#modal #modal_history_body .history_detail_year img{width:85px;height:auto}}#modal #modal_history_body .history_detail_year span{position:absolute;left:50%;bottom:0;display:flex;justify-content:center;align-items:center;width:400px;height:150px;transform:translateX(-50%);color:#920e14;font-size:20px;font-weight:bold;text-align:center;font-feature-settings:"palt"}@media print,screen and (max-width: 819px){#modal #modal_history_body .history_detail_year span{width:100%;height:110px;font-size:3.6vw}}#modal #modal_history_body .history_detail{width:90%;margin:0 auto 20px;padding:20px 0;text-align:center;background-color:#fff5e0;border-radius:10px}@media print,screen and (min-width: 820px){#modal #modal_history_body .history_detail{margin:0 auto 20px;text-align:center}}#modal #modal_history_body .history_detail img{width:auto;height:150px}@media print,screen and (max-width: 819px){#modal #modal_history_body .history_detail img{height:120px}}#modal #modal_history_body .history_detail.long img{width:100%;height:auto}@media print,screen and (min-width: 820px){#modal #modal_history_body .history_detail.long{height:160px}#modal #modal_history_body .history_detail.long img{width:auto;height:100%}}#modal #modal_history_body .history_detail.long2{width:90%;margin:0 auto 20px;padding:20px 5%}#modal #modal_history_body .history_detail.long2 img{width:100%;height:auto}#modal #modal_history_body .history_detail_txt{width:90%;margin:0 auto;color:#821a1f;font-size:3.2vw;text-align:justify;line-height:1.4}#modal #modal_history_body .history_detail_txt.sub{margin-top:10px;font-size:100%}@media print,screen and (min-width: 820px){#modal #modal_history_body .history_detail_txt{font-size:15px}}#modal #modal_close{position:absolute;right:-30px;top:-30px;cursor:pointer;width:46px}/*# sourceMappingURL=history.css.map */
